The Pursuit of Justice and the Common Good
St. Hilary Catholic Parish and Faith Lutheran Church are pleased to be collaborating in the 2012 Lenten Speakers Series on
social justice. Each evening begins with a Soup Supper followed by Evening Prayer. 6:00 pm Soup Supper ▲ 7:00 pm Evening Prayer
at 7:00 pm ▲7:30-9:00 pm Presentation Babysitting provided. RSVP church@sthilarychurch.org.
The Biblical Roots of Living Justly for the Common Good
What do we learn from Jesus’ teaching, Scripture, Tradition and church teaching about living justly and the common good?
Wednesday, February 29 (at St. Hilary)
Speaker: Rev. Joseph J. Fortuna, S.T.D. Father Fortuna is pastor of Our Lady of the Lake, Euclid and adjunct professor, St. Mary Seminary School of Theology.
The Challenge of Living Justly for the Common Good
What are the challenges we face as consumers, citizens, and Christians when we allow the common good to impact our decisions?
Wednesday, March 7 (at Faith Lutheran)
Speaker: Maureen McCarthy, O.S.U., D.Min. Ms. McCarthy’s background includes being an educator at every level; national and international
presentations on Scripture and spirituality; leadership roles in healthcare administration for the Ursuline sisters of Cleveland; membership
on numerous educational and healthcare boards.
Opportunities to Live Justly Here and Now
What are the organizations and programs that exist in our community which are providing opportunities for us to practice justice and further the common good?
Speakers: Team from Humility of Mary Housing, Inc.
Humility of Mary Housing Ministry provides family, transitional, and senior housing facilities and programs for the needy of our community.
